Key Responsibilities:
- Cutover planning: Develop and manage the detailed cutover plan, outlining activities, resources, and timelines required for the transition from legacy systems to Oracle ERP.
- Stakeholder coordination: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including IT, business units, and external vendors, to ensure alignment on cutover activities and readiness.
- Risk management: Identify and mitigate potential risks associated with cutover activities, including data migration, system outages, and user access issues.
- Communication: Act as the main point of contact for all cutover-related communications, keeping stakeholders informed of timelines, activities, and any issues or changes.
- Data migration oversight: Coordinate data migration activities with technical teams, ensuring data integrity and accuracy through pre- and post-migration checks.
- Testing and validation: Work with QA and functional teams to develop and execute cutover testing plans, ensuring systems are fully operational before go-live.
- Contingency planning: Develop and maintain contingency plans for critical cutover activities, preparing for potential delays, rollbacks, or system issues.
- Post-cutover support: Oversee post-cutover stabilization activities, ensuring any issues are addressed quickly and that end-users have the support they need.
- Documentation: Create and maintain comprehensive documentation for all cutover activities, including step-by-step procedures, roles and responsibilities, and lessons learned.
- Continuous improvement: After cutover, conduct a post-mortem review and implement best practices for future deployments or upgrades.
